Harnessing it's Power of Edge Computing for AI Applications

Edge computing has emerged as a transformative technology, enabling powerful new capabilities for artificial intelligence (AI) applications. By processing data closer to its source, edge computing reduces latency, improves real-time responsiveness, and enhances the overall efficiency of AI models. This distributed computing paradigm empowers a vast range of industries to leverage AI at the front, unlocking new possibilities in areas such as autonomous driving.

Edge devices can now execute complex AI algorithms locally, enabling real-time insights and actions. This eliminates the need to send data to centralized cloud servers, which can be time-consuming and resource-intensive. Consequently, edge computing empowers AI applications to operate in offline environments, where connectivity may be restricted.

Furthermore, the decentralized nature of edge computing enhances data security and privacy by keeping sensitive information localized on devices. This is particularly important for applications that handle personal data, such as healthcare or finance.

In conclusion, edge computing provides a powerful platform for accelerating AI innovation and deployment. By bringing computation to the edge, we can unlock new levels of efficiency in AI applications across a multitude of industries.

The Future of AI is at the Edge

As cloud computing evolves, the future of artificial intelligence (deep learning) is increasingly shifting to the edge. This movement brings several advantages. Firstly, processing data locally reduces latency, enabling real-time use cases. Secondly, edge AI conserves bandwidth by performing calculations closer to the information, minimizing strain on centralized networks. Thirdly, edge AI facilitates decentralized systems, fostering greater robustness.

  • Finally, edge AI is poised to revolutionize industries by bringing the power of AI immediately to where it's needed
